DES PLAINES, Ill. – The Harper College men's basketball team travels to Oakton Community College tonight for a 7 PM tip.
The Hawks (4-6) are looking to win back-to-back games for the first time this season while the Raiders (3-7) have lost five of their last six games. Harper won its last game against the Olivet Nazarene JV team last Thursday night, and Oakton is coming off a loss to Kishwaukee College on Saturday.
Last Meeting
The two teams last met on Dec. 10, 2013 in Palatine, a game the Hawks won 76-65. Former Hawks Kevin Walsh (/St. Viator) and Kevin Sexton (/Prospect) led the way with 28 and 16 points, respectively.
Key Hawks
Robert Hudson (Hoffman Estates, Ill./Conant) (16.3 PPG, 5.9 RPG) and Admir Suljic (Chicago, Ill. /Lane Tech) (15.6 PPG) are the Hawks' top two scorers. Hudson has scored in double figures in all nine games he's played and was named the NJCAA Region IV Player of the Week on Nov. 17. Suljic is coming off a career-high 35 points and 12 rebounds in the win over Olivet JV. He has been lethal from 3-point land this season, shooting 45.3 percent (24-of-53).
Davion Benton (Chicago, Ill. /Alcott College Prep) also averages in double figures scoring at 10.9 PPG and is the team's top rebounder at 8.5 RPG. Marcus Gatlin (Chicago, Ill./Curie) (6.1 PPG), Jamal Sherman (Des Plaines, Ill./Maine West) (5.9 PPG) and Jalon Roundy (Palatine, Ill./Fremd) (4.9 PPG)will also be relied on for scoring.
Key Raiders
Zerell Jackson leads the Raiders in scoring at 15.0 PPG. Anthony Cole (13.2 PPG), Chris Medard (9.6 PPG) and Connor Nass (8.0 PPG) are all formidable scoring options for Oakton.
